-
- 使用Atoum测试PHP代码 - Phpunit的替代方案
- Atoum:用于PHP测试的PHPUNIT的替代品 Atoum是当代PHP测试框架,提出了Phpunit的引人注目的替代方案。 其流利的界面优先考虑可读性并简化了测试创建。 该教程Ex
- php教程 . 后端开发 992 2025-02-10 12:16:09
-
- 每个人的本地作曲家!会议友好的Satis设置
- 本文解释了如何在网络上设置本地Satis实例,以托管作曲家软件包,从而使脱机软件包检索。 它消除了对访问软件包的互联网连接的需求。 关键概念: 本地软件包托管:
- php教程 . 后端开发 1031 2025-02-10 12:13:10
-
- 如何通过SMS使用2FA保护Laravel应用程序
- 本文演示了如何使用Twilio SMS进行验证将两因素身份验证(2FA)集成到Laravel应用程序中。 它通过需要密码和通过SMS发送的一次性代码来增强安全性。 关键功能: SMS verifica
- php教程 . 后端开发 1099 2025-02-10 12:04:12
-
- 如何使用CouchdB创建口袋妖怪Spawn位置录音机
- 在上一篇文章中,您已被介绍给CouchDB。这次,您将创建一个成熟的应用程序,可以在其中应用自己学到的知识。您还将学习如何在教程结束时保护数据库。 关键点
- php教程 . 后端开发 779 2025-02-10 12:01:13
-
- 在PHP 7.1中,什么是新颖而令人兴奋的?
- PHP 7.1 的重要更新:提升性能和代码可读性 PHP 7.1 版本带来了许多令人兴奋的新特性,显着提升了性能和代码可读性。本文重点介绍其中一些最关键的改进,更多细节请参考 PHP RFC。 1. ArgumentCountError 异常: 在 PHP 7.1 之前,函数参数数量不足只会产生警告。现在,参数不足将抛出 ArgumentCountError 异常,这使得错误处理更加清晰有效。 // PHP 7.1 function sum($a, $b) { return $a
- php教程 . 后端开发 258 2025-02-10 11:56:09
-
- 跳到PHP到GO:亵渎,勇敢还是常识?
- 核心要点 将Boxzilla应用的底层Laravel应用从PHP迁移到Go,最终得到一个更高效的程序,具有更好的性能、更简单的部署和更高的测试覆盖率,尽管最初对潜在的业务风险有所担忧。 Go是一种编译型语言,其标准库优于PHP,即使考虑外部依赖项,也能生成更快、更小的应用程序,代码行数更少。从PHP到Go的转换需要适应新的语法和特性,但最终结果被认为是值得的。 尽管PHP拥有更大的社区和丰富的资源,但Go日益普及、简单易用以及卓越的性能特性使其成为开发人员考虑转换的有力竞争者。作者预测,未来将
- php教程 . 后端开发 444 2025-02-10 11:51:24
-
- 从HTTP消息到PSR-7:这一切
- PSR-7:PHP中HTTP消息的标准化方法 PHP框架互操作性组(PHP-FIG)具有用PSR-7标准化的HTTP消息处理。该规范定义了代表HTTP消息的七个接口,促进Inter
- php教程 . 后端开发 1146 2025-02-10 11:50:09
-
- 用Laravel中间件中断应用程序
- 本文解释了Laravel 5中间件:它是什么,为什么需要它以及如何使用它。 它还包括视频教程和一个常见问题解答部分。 在潜入Laravel中间件之前,让我们定义它。 中间件是连接不同S的软件
- php教程 . 后端开发 308 2025-02-10 11:48:10
-
- 什么?为什么有人会破解我的小企业网站?
- 小企业网站安全:自动化攻击与防护策略 小型企业网站常常成为网络犯罪分子攻击的目标,其动机通常是经济利益。这些网络罪犯会利用被入侵的网站传播恶意软件、进行SEO垃圾邮件攻击,甚至建立垃圾邮件服务器和网络钓鱼网站。向合法网站注入反向链接和垃圾邮件是一种特别有利可图且流行的攻击类型。 自动化攻击的现实 网站入侵在很大程度上是自动化的,这意味着黑客无需亲自访问网站即可入侵。这种对攻击执行方式的误解往往使小型企业对威胁毫无准备。如果没有基本的维护、安全措施和适当的监控,任何网站都可能面临被篡改和感染恶意
- php教程 . 后端开发 530 2025-02-10 11:45:10
-
- 单文件符号应用程序?是的,与微芯片!
- Symfony的单个文件应用程序(SFA)使用MicrokernelTrait:一种简化的方法 Symfony 2.8和3.0介绍了单个文件应用程序(SFA),这是一种构建Symfony应用程序的简化方法,对微服务特别有用或
- php教程 . 后端开发 518 2025-02-10 11:43:09
-
- Laravel快速提示:模型路线绑定
- Laravel路由组件:简化高效的路由管理 本文探讨Laravel强大的路由组件,它提供简洁高效的路由管理方式,支持简洁的URL、参数、分组、命名以及路由组的事件保护等特性。其路由模型绑定功能通过类型提示模型名称而非ID参数,简化了重复性任务的处理。 核心要点: Laravel的路由组件提供简单高效的路由管理方式,支持简洁URL、参数、分组、命名以及事件保护路由组等功能。路由模型绑定功能通过类型提示模型名称而非ID参数,简化了重复性任务处理。 Laravel的路由模型绑定会自动使用ID参数解
- php教程 . 后端开发 1059 2025-02-10 11:35:12
-
- 在PHP中创建严格键入的数组和收集
- 关键要点 PHP 5.6介绍了使用…代币创建键入数组的能力,该功能或方法接受可变的参数长度。此功能可以与类型提示结合使用,以确保只有某些类型的O
- php教程 . 后端开发 286 2025-02-10 11:20:11
-
- 制作自己的社交网络,游戏服务器或知识库! - 源头
- 本月的SourceHunt强调了有希望的开源项目成熟的捐款! 我们已经策划了需要GitHub星星并提取请求的项目选择,从而提供了回馈开源社区的机会。 特色Proj
- php教程 . 后端开发 1056 2025-02-10 11:14:09
-
- 升级Sylius TDD方式:探索PhpsPec
- 本文展示了使用测试驱动的开发(TDD)扩展Sylius的核心功能,以改善库存管理。 我们将在产品列表中添加颜色编码的低储物指标。 这将是后端实施;视觉TE
- php教程 . 后端开发 713 2025-02-10 11:13:13